1

Я просто настроил Owncloud в своем общем веб-пространстве и получил все, кроме проверки подлинности с настольных клиентов. Если я захожу на URL-адрес WebDAV через веб-браузер, он просто снова представляет мне пустую форму, а клиент для рабочего стола owncloud сообщает: Error: Wrong Credentials

Если я захожу на URL-адрес WebDAV через браузер, в который я только что вошел через веб-интерфейс, он показывает мне каталог (меня не спрашивают имя пользователя / пароль)

Мой пароль не содержит символов, отличных от az, AZ, 0-9

Журнал предупреждений:

curl_setopt_array() [<a href='function.curl-setopt-array'>function.curl-setopt-array</a>]: CURLOPT_FOLLOWLOCATION cannot be activated when safe_mode is enabled or an open_basedir is set at /path/to/my/home/cloud/3rdparty/Sabre/DAV/Client.php#462

Вы можете попробовать здесь: http://martinbertschler.com/cloud/ с пропуском пользователя: demo demo

1 ответ1

1

По их дэвам GitHub здесь, CURLOPT_FOLLOWLOCATION не может быть использован на всех , когда open_basedir установлен.

Они также обеспечивают PHP обходной путь здесь, но идея будет удалить open_basedir из вашего php.ini.

Я предлагаю комментировать это. Это должно относиться к журналу ошибок, который вы разместили, тогда мы сможем увидеть, что работает, и перейдем оттуда.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.